Cooking Instructions
- Fill a large pot with water, adding a generous pinch of salt, and bring it to a rolling boil over high heat. Once boiling, add your spaghetti and cook according to the package instructions—typically around 8-10 minutes—until al dente.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king, and when done, drain the pasta, reserving a bit of pasta water for the sauce.
- While the pasta cooks, heat a large skillet over medium heat and melt 2 tablespoons of butter. Add 3-4 cloves of minced garlic and sauté for about 1-2 minutes until fragrant and lightly golden.
- Next, pour in 1 cup of heavy cream into the skillet and reduce the heat to low. Stir the mixture gently while allowing it to simmer for 3-4 minutes, letting it thicken slightly.
- Add in 1 cup of grated Parmesan cheese, stirring until melted and fully combined.
- Add the drained spaghetti to the skillet with the sauce, tossing until every noodle is well coated. Season with freshly cracked black pepper to taste.
- Once everything is combined, remove the skillet from heat and serve immediately in warm bowls.

Notes
For best taste, use freshly minced garlic and adjust the sauce consistency with reserved pasta water if needed.
